Prometheus告警级别与报警通知有何区别?
在当今数字化时代,监控系统对于企业来说至关重要。Prometheus 作为一款开源监控工具,在监控领域有着广泛的应用。在 Prometheus 中,告警级别与报警通知是两个重要的概念,它们在监控过程中扮演着不同的角色。那么,Prometheus 告警级别与报警通知有何区别呢?本文将为您详细解析这两个概念。
一、Prometheus 告警级别
Prometheus 告警级别指的是根据告警规则的严重程度对告警进行分类。在 Prometheus 中,告警级别主要分为以下几种:
- 紧急告警(Critical):表示系统出现严重问题,可能导致业务中断。例如,数据库连接失败、服务器崩溃等。
- 严重告警(High):表示系统出现较严重问题,可能影响部分业务功能。例如,磁盘空间不足、网络延迟等。
- 普通告警(Normal):表示系统出现一般性问题,可能对业务影响较小。例如,服务响应时间较长、日志异常等。
- 信息告警(Informational):表示系统运行正常,但存在一些潜在问题。例如,某个接口调用次数增加等。
二、Prometheus 报警通知
Prometheus 报警通知是指当告警触发时,系统会向相关人员发送通知,以便及时处理问题。报警通知的方式多种多样,常见的有以下几种:
- 邮件通知:将告警信息以邮件形式发送给相关人员。
- 短信通知:通过短信平台将告警信息发送给相关人员。
- 即时通讯工具通知:通过微信、钉钉等即时通讯工具发送告警信息。
- 电话通知:通过电话平台将告警信息发送给相关人员。
三、Prometheus 告警级别与报警通知的区别
- 触发条件不同:告警级别是根据告警规则的严重程度进行分类,而报警通知是根据告警触发时的情况进行通知。
- 作用不同:告警级别主要用于对告警进行分类,便于管理员了解问题的严重程度;报警通知则用于将告警信息及时通知给相关人员,以便及时处理问题。
- 通知方式不同:告警级别本身并不涉及通知方式,而报警通知则规定了具体的通知方式。
四、案例分析
假设某企业使用 Prometheus 对其数据库进行监控,设置了一条告警规则:当数据库连接数超过 1000 时,触发紧急告警。此时,当数据库连接数超过 1000 时,Prometheus 会触发紧急告警,并将告警信息以邮件形式发送给数据库管理员。数据库管理员收到邮件后,会立即处理该问题,避免业务中断。
五、总结
Prometheus 告警级别与报警通知是监控系统中的两个重要概念,它们在监控过程中发挥着不同的作用。了解这两个概念的区别,有助于管理员更好地进行监控和问题处理。在实际应用中,应根据业务需求合理配置告警级别和报警通知,以确保监控系统的高效运行。
猜你喜欢:网络可视化